Output effcb96cde31e16d869ec733402ff93bb1ccdd4c69f799dcd7830d0fedd893d3:67

value
19503
script pubkey
OP_0 OP_PUSHBYTES_20 2838bc10a6b1e03a60686aa35f3177f0e759b1b8
address
bc1q9qutcy9xk8sr5crgd2347vth7rn4nvdck2mvhm
transaction
effcb96cde31e16d869ec733402ff93bb1ccdd4c69f799dcd7830d0fedd893d3
confirmations
73757
spent
true